Which edicts did the parlements refuse to register in Brienne's 1787 reforms?

Introducing landed tax or removing tax exemptions

2
New cards

Why did the parlements refuse to pass the edicts?

They said they did not have the authority or legitimacy to pass it, an Estates-General should be called

3
New cards

Why did crowds assemble in Paris in 1787?

Calling for an Estates-General, inspired by the refusal of the Parlements to pass the reforms

4
New cards

Where was the Paris parlement exiled to by Louis XVI?

Troyes

5
New cards

When did Louis XVI end the exile and call the Paris parlement for a Seance Royale?

November 1787

6
New cards

What did Louis XVI's May Edicts do? (1788)

Removed the power of the parlements by enstating a new court of nobles, magistrates selected by Louis and transferring their legal work to lower courts

7
New cards

After the May edicts, how did the 2nd estate react?

There were demonstrations and disturbances over France (mainly 2nd estate, but also 3rd)- ARISTOCRATIC REVOLT

8
New cards

What happened on the Day of Tiles?

In Grenoble, there was a demonstration in support of the parlements (part of the aristocratic revolt), in attempt from the army to squash the uprising, 4 died and 30 were injured

9
New cards

How did the 1st estate support the revolts?

Gave a Don Gratuit of under 1/4 of the usual amount- exacerbates economic crisis
